Elizabeth Frew was born about 1849 at Kilwinning, Ayrshire. Scotland. She was the daughter of John Frew and Elizabeth McKechan.
John Watson married Elizabeth Frew 30 April 1869 at Kilwinning, Ayrshire, Scotland. [1]
John Watson age 30 and Elizabeth Watson age 26 and their family emigrated from Scotland, via London, England to Queensland, Australia in 1875. They arrived in Queensland on 26 February 1876 on board the ship 'Indus'. [2]
Elizabeth (Frew) Watson passed away 18 September 1883 at Gympie, Queensland, Australia. [3]
Notes:
Elizabeth was about 20 yrs of age when she married John Watson.
Although I have been unable to find an OPR for her birth she was found through a Poor Relief record in Kilwinning dated 1864 which gave information on her as well as information on her father John Frew who had left Ayrshire for Pennsylvania.[4]
Her mother Elizabeth had died in 1862 about 2 years following the birth of her last child Margaret Frew and sister to Elizabeth Frew.

Note: Bleaching Mills: The chief industry in the Renfrew and Paisley villages was formerly bleaching and the finishing of cotton cloth and thread in preparation of looming. Two main bleaching works existed at Bowfield and Midtownfield, the former being the last to close in the 1960s.
